CHICAGO, Ill. – The Scarlet Hawks were victorious for the second time in three matches and for the first time in Northern Athletics Collegiate Conference (NACC) play on Friday evening in the Keating Sports Center. Tech (3-9, 1-2 NACC) took down Rockford College (4-13, 0-3 NACC) in dominant fashion, winning in straight sets.

Set Scores

  • Tech 3, RU 0 (25-20, 25-12, 25-15)

How it Happend

  • The Scarlet Hawks took advantage of some costly Regents attack errors early on to build a 5-2 lead, but the visitors would reel Tech in. Behind a 6-0 run that included two service aces from Nicole Eggers, Rockford took its largest lead of the evening at 12-8.
  • Behind two kills from Karen Marrufo-Zubaran, the Scarlet Hawks would rally right back with a 5-0 run to retake the lead. While Rockford would sprinkle in a few points, Tech remained in control the rest of the set and capped it off with an Alyssa Miner kill.
  • Tech's momentum carried over into the second set, taking a 7-1 lead. Rockford never really threatened, as the Scarlet Hawks built a lead throughout. Jessica Weaver gave Tech a boost at the end of the set, coming off the bench to record kills for two of the team's last four points.
  • Allison Wilkins began set three with a service ace, which kicked off a 9-1 run. Rockford would put together two different 3-0 runs to attempt a comeback, but the Scarlet Hawks responded with a countering 3-0 run each time. This time, it was Leah van der Sanden providing the exclamation point with the final kill of the match.

Scarlet Hawk Standouts

  • Several Scarlet Hawks stood out on the attack this evening. Taylor Burton (nine kills, .643%, two block assists), Alyssa Miner (three kills, .333%, two block assists), and Weaver (three kills, .750%, one block assist) were all strong in the middle.
  • Justine Bracco and Mia Phelps each contributed five kills from the right side. Bracco had a .445 hit percentage as well.
  • Tech's four-setter lineup of Courtney Darling (11), Wilkins (nine, three aces), Natalie Freund (five), and Zoey Kriethe (three) combined for 28 assists.
  • Courtney Curcio (14) and Marrufo-Zubaran (10, four kills) each had double-digit dig numbers.

Stats to Know

  • The Scarlet Hawks outhit the Rockford 33-19 in kills and .267% to .022% in the percentage game.
  • Rockford tallied 17 attack errors, six service errors, and 11 ball handling errors, giving Tech the upper hand in building runs.
  • The Scarlet Hawks held the Regents without a block.
